Why Window Tinting is Crucial for Electric Vehicles Like the Kia EV3
The Kia EV3, a popular compact electric SUV, benefits significantly from high-quality window tinting. For EV owners, maintaining driving range is paramount, and this is directly impacted by cabin temperature. Unlike internal combustion engine vehicles, electric cars rely on battery power for air conditioning, making effective heat rejection from window film essential. The EV3's expansive glass surfaces allow considerable heat to enter, so professional window tinting plays a vital role in preserving interior comfort and maximizing driving efficiency. Choosing the right window film is therefore a critical decision for EV3 owners.
Understanding Reflective vs. Non-Reflective Window Films
A common dilemma for car owners is choosing between reflective and non-reflective window films. While the most obvious difference is aesthetics – reflective films offer a mirror-like exterior – their heat-blocking mechanisms differ significantly. Non-reflective films absorb external heat and then re-emit some of it back into the cabin. In contrast, reflective films, like the Glasstint Sunset series, are engineered to bounce external heat away from the vehicle. This superior heat reflection typically results in a higher Total Solar Energy Rejection (TSER) rating, leading to a cooler interior and contributing to better battery efficiency for the EV3.
Glasstint Sunset: Balancing Privacy and Performance
The Glasstint Sunset film offers a compelling blend of robust heat rejection and enhanced privacy, making it an excellent choice for vehicles like the white Kia EV3. Its semi-reflective nature complements lighter car colors, adding a touch of sophistication. Available in various shades (30%, 10%, and 06%), it allows for customized application across the vehicle, ensuring both optimal privacy and clear visibility, especially during nighttime driving. For this Kia EV3, a 30% tint on the front windshield and 10% on the side and rear windows provided a perfect balance, effectively blocking heat while maintaining a clear view from the inside.
Kia EV3 Window Tinting Installation Process:
- Surface Preparation: The vehicle's windows are meticulously cleaned and degreased to ensure optimal adhesion of the window film.
- Film Cutting: The Glasstint Sunset film is precisely cut to match the exact dimensions of each Kia EV3 window, often using specialized cutting machines.
- Application: Using a mild soap and water solution, the film is carefully applied to the interior side of the glass, with heat and squeegees used to remove air bubbles and conform the film to the window's curvature.
- Curing: The film requires a curing period, typically a few days to a week, during which it's best to avoid rolling down windows to allow the adhesive to fully bond.
Maintaining Your Window Tint
Reflective films like Glasstint Sunset may take slightly longer than non-reflective films to fully cure and for any initial moisture or minor bubbles to dissipate completely. Patience during the initial drying period is key. Avoid aggressive cleaning or using abrasive materials on the film for at least a week after installation to ensure its longevity and maintain its pristine appearance.

Q. What is the difference between ceramic and dyed window tint for a Kia EV3?
Ceramic window tint uses non-metallic ceramic particles to block heat, offering excellent heat rejection and durability without affecting electronic signals, while dyed tint uses a layer of dye to absorb heat and reduce glare. For the best performance and longevity on a Kia EV3, ceramic tint is generally the superior choice.
